عنوان انگلیسی مقاله ISI
Unraveling the mechanism of thermal and thermo-oxidative degradation of tannic acid

چکیده انگلیسی


• The thermal degradation mechanism of tannic acid has been investigated.
• Py–GC–MS and TGA–FTIR are used to examine the products of degradation in gas phase.
• The char study of tannic acid at various temperatures was carried with ATR–FTIR.
• A mechanistic pathway for thermal degradation of tannic acid has been proposed.

The thermal and thermo-oxidative degradation of hydrolysable tannin, i.e. tannic acid is reported. The study on thermal and thermo-oxidative degradation mechanism of tannic acid was carried out by using several advanced thermal characterization techniques such as Thermogravimetric analysis (TGA) coupled with Fourier-Transform Infrared (FTIR) Spectroscopy (TGA–FTIR), pyrolysis–gas chromatography–mass spectroscopy (Py–GC–MS) and Attenuated Total Reflectance (ATR)–FTIR. The condensed phase and gaseous phase degradation studies were combined to deduce a probable degradation pathway for tannic acid molecule at high temperature under nitrogen and air atmosphere.
